Adelynn Outwood and Theo Marlow used to see each other almost every day. He was her older sister's best friend, and she was just a kid lingering somewhere in the background - a young girl who fell in love too early, too deeply, and without the slightest chance of it ever being returned.
When she was thirteen, Theo was everything to her. The problem was that he was five years older - and at that age, five years was an impossible gap to bridge. To him, she was only a child, curled up on the couch while he and her sister's friends were watching movies in the living room. To her, he was her first love - the one she never told anyone about.
Then came the fight. Brutal. Final. The friendship between him and her sister's friend's group shattered, and Theo disappeared from her life as suddenly as he had become a part of it. Years passed. They hadn't seen each other since.
Until now.
As Adelynn begins her second year of college, Theo walks back into her life as if no time has passed at all.
Except she's no longer a child. And he's no longer an untouchable dream. But the past doesn't stay buried just because you've outgrown it. This time, facing each other might mean confronting everything they left unsaid.
